When the temperature sensor 72752 in your Samsung DE81-07435A appliance begins to malfunction, you may need to replace it. Replacing the temperature sensor can be a difficult and time consuming task. However, with some patience and the right tools and materials, replacing it yourself is possible. Here is a guide on how to replace the Samsung DE81-07435A TEMPERATURE SENSOR 72752.
Tools & Materials Needed:
• Phillips head screwdriver
• Flathead screwdriver
• Safety goggles
• Pliers
• New Samsung DE81-07435A TEMPERATURE SENSOR 72752
Instructions:
1. Unplug the appliance from the power source and turn off the gas supply to the appliance.
2. Remove the screws that secure the access panel and remove the access panel to expose the sensor.
3. Remove the existing temperature sensor by using a flathead screwdriver to unscrew the sensor from its base.
4. Disconnect the wires from the old sensor (you may need to use pliers).
5. Connect the new sensor’s wires to the appliance’s wiring.
6. Secure the sensor in place by using a Phillips head screwdriver to tighten the screws.
7. Replace the access panel and secure with screws.
8. Turn on the gas supply and plug the appliance back in to the power source.
9. Test the new sensor and ensure that it is functioning properly.
By following these steps, you will be able to successfully replace the Samsung DE81-07435A TEMPERATURE SENSOR 72752. Always take safety precautions and always be sure to turn off the gas supply before beginning any repairs.
